I have always found visitors from the US to be very polite and friendly so I was very surprised to meet what may be an “Ugly American” in a small Chinese restaurant in Waterford.

"Ugly American" is a pejorative term used to refer to perceptions of loud, arrogant, demeaning, thoughtless, ignorant, and ethnocentric behaviour of American citizens mainly abroad, but also at home.

For about 15 minutes I was the only customer in the restaurant and then an elderly American and his wife arrived. They both sat down at a table at the other the side of the restaurant. Soon after the gentleman said “sir, did you not hear me”. I said sorry, I was not paying attention. He then said in a very aggressive manner “do you have a problem?”. At this stage the waitress arrived with the menus.

The couple looked at the menus and then I heard him say to his wife “let’s go, I don’t like the sort of people that they serve in this restaurant”. They then called the waitress and said they they were leaving as they do not eat Chinese food.

On his way out he said something to me that could not be repeated here.
